If `A+B+C= pi/2`, show that : `sin^2 A + sin^2 B + sin^2 C=1-2 sinA sinB sinC`

To prove that \( \sin^2 A + \sin^2 B + \sin^2 C = 1 - 2 \sin A \sin B \sin C \) given that \( A + B + C = \frac{\pi}{2} \), we can follow these steps: ### Step 1: Express \( A + B \) Since \( A + B + C = \frac{\pi}{2} \), we can express \( A + B \) as: \[ A + B = \frac{\pi}{2} - C \] ...
